About The Position

Bennett Venture Academy, located in Toledo, OH, is seeking an Achievement and Behavior Support Specialist to join their team. This role is crucial in developing individualized behavior and academic plans for students, collaborating with teachers and specialists to implement intervention strategies, and fostering a positive school culture through the responsible thinking process. The academy, established in 2006, serves over 600 K-8 students and offers a supportive environment with experienced leadership, competitive pay, and a focus on student success.
